You'll typically require an extra key that functions and a programming device. It is also recommended to have the owner's manual for your car handy. The reprogramming procedure will vary depending on the type of vehicle.
Start by inserting the working key into the ignition and turning it to the on position. This will trigger the system to enter programming mode.
Getting an entirely new key
It can be a hassle to get in your car if you've lost the keys. There are a few simple steps you can follow to reprogram a key. The procedure may differ according to the car you're using, so it's important to follow the directions for your specific vehicle. You can find the complete instructions in the owner's manual or on the manufacturer's website.
Insert the second key into your vehicle. It could be a new key or an alternative working key, but it has to have the same chip as your original key. After that, you'll have to turn the key off and on repeatedly until it goes into security mode. Once you've done this, you'll have just a few seconds to insert your new key.
After inserting the second key into the ignition, you can take the key out. This will reset the electronic components of the key and allow you to start the vehicle. Repeat this step to reprogram any other keys you require.

Finding a key chip
A key chip is a small microchip inside your car's key that transmits a low-level radio signal. The signal signals the immobilizer that it can be disengaged and you can start your vehicle. The chips come with an electronic serial that authenticates and stops auto-theft. A locksmith can offer you an alternative key to replace your lost one. It is simple and quick, and will save you money in the end.
There are several methods available online that claim to to modify your key, but they are not recommended for the average user. These methods are risky and carry a high chance of corrupting the information stored in your car's security system. It is better to contact an experienced locksmith who is equipped with the latest equipment.
These services are offered at most locksmith shops and on the internet. These websites offer a variety options for reprogramming keys, including keys that have been programmed. It is important to note that not all keyfobs work with all cars. They are designed to be compatible with specific models, makes and year vehicles. They need to be connected to the correct vehicle before they can function.
The first step to reprogramme your key is to buy the key blank that matches your car's chip. They are available at auto parts stores. Then, you'll need to locate the ECU in your vehicle. It is usually located under the dash but check the owner's manual for sure. You will need to connect the diagnostic device once you have located the ECU. The device helps programme the car's electronic components to accept the new ignition key.
Once the key has been changed, it will work like your previous one. The key fob could also be used to unlock doors or start your engine. You will save time and money on fuel, and your car will be secure from thieves. In these circumstances, it's a good idea to have a spare key in the event that you lose your key.

Finding a locksmith
When you have lost keys to your car, or have an ignition key that has was not functioning, a locksmith can reprogram it to function again. This is an easy and secure method to get back on the road. You may also ask locksmiths for assistance with other services like making a new key or removing damaged key. Some locksmiths offer the option of mobile service, which allows you to receive the assistance you require.
Many vehicles have upgraded transponder technology within their keys to stop theft. This means that they must be programmed in order to match the anti-theft system of your vehicle. This can be done by the car locksmith service or the mechanic or dealer. This is an expensive process that requires a special software and equipment that is specialized. DIY is a method to save money, but it's risky and could damage the system.
